This single storey cottage in Garelochhead sleeps eight people in four bedrooms.
Heatherbank is a single storey cottage on the edge of Garelochhead village in Argyllshire. The cottage has All ground floor. Four bedrooms. 2 x double bed en suite, 2 x double bed with shared bathroom. Dining area, living room with bar, new refurbished kitchen.. Outside is off road parking for two cars, and a garden to the front with patio and mountain views. Apart from the many Munros offering superb walking, Garelochhead is close to Helensburgh, a popular and busy seaside resort. Heatherbank is an easy walk from the shores of Gare Loch and the amenities of the village, and Loch Lomond is within easy reach.
Amenities: Electric central heating Electric oven and hob, microwave, fridge/freezer, Dishwasher, washing machine,, BBQ, Hot Tub, TV with Sky, DVD, CD, WiFi, telephone (incoming calls only), USB sockets in each bedroom, selection of books, games and DVDs. Fuel and power inc. in rent. Bed linen and towels inc. in rent. Cot and highchair on request. Off road parking for 4 cars. Gardens to the front with new patio, side and rear garden secure. Sorry, no pets and no smoking. Shop and pub 10 mins walk. Note: The road leading to the property is of good quality. Note: The hot tub may not reach temperature until the morning after check in.

Town: Garelochhead is a small village at the head of Gare Loch, a large sea loch known for sailing and sea angling. The village has a selection of shops and pubs, and is close to great walking, munro-bagging and golf. Loch Lomond is within easy reach.
